Windsor Contemporary Art Fair 08 Bigger than Ever Announces Opening in November
Sasha Bowles, The Other Room.



WINDSOR.- The fair brings together an exciting mix of over 75 artists, printmakers, photographers, sculptors, ceramicists and selected galleries offering the very best in contemporary art with prices from £30 to £3,000. As one of only a few art fairs operating for both galleries and independent artists, it allows visitors to meet and buy from established and emerging artists directly and also see a more diverse range from professional galleries.

The formula proved successful in 2007 with over 3,500 visitors. This year the even wider choice of art from exhibitors from all over the UK and Europe and additional interactive activities - silk painting, art mobiles, ‘antiques road show’ style art valuations and drawing workshops by Harry Potter illustrator Cliff Wright – will make this an event not to be missed. The website www.windsorcontemporaryartfair.co.uk gives art enthusiasts a taste of what's to come.

Organiser Sarah McAllister confirmed the shows increasing popularity. "Since its conception in 2005 Windsor Contemporary Art Fair has gone from strength to strength, attracting top quality artists and galleries. It has proved to be exceptionally popular with local art buyers who no longer need to travel to London to see a comprehensive and exciting selection.”

The event will be held at Royal Windsor Racecourse over 3 days - 7th-9th November 2008. Friday 10am - 6pm, Saturday 10am - 5pm, Sunday 10am - 5pm.

Tickets are £5.00 for adults, £4.00 Concessions, Children under 12 are free.

Café and wine tasting through the weekend.

The fair continues its support for The Prince's Trust through a sale of original miniature canvases.
